 so‧bri‧e‧ty /səˈbraɪəti/ 
 noun [uncountable] formal[
Date: 1400-1500; 
Language: Old French; 
Origin: sobrieté, from Latin sobrietas, from sobrius;  ⇒ sober1]
1.  when someone is not drunk: 
 John had periods of sobriety, but always went back to drinking.2.
